Attention all riders. A word of caution. Should you go into JB by 1st link that is through Woodlands checkpoint, please ride carefully and slowly once you passed the JB customs. It seems that there are a LOT of potholes and gravel once you exit the customs especially at the U-turn and into Jalan Wong Ah Fook. Even the roads after the flyover towards JB customs heading to Singapore suffer the same problem. The roads must have been made of low quality products that after many days of rain, the ground just softened and break under pressure from all the vehicles. Luckily I noticed the problem, if not sure buang. Just ride slow and steady guys... :goodluck: :thumb:

Originally posted by Dewei@Jan 17 2006, 12:56 AM

Hi. Think of changing the following item for my CBR954.

1) Tyre. Did anyone use or see this new Dunlop QUALIFIER tyre b4? Think of trying it...coz magazine rated this tyre highly. And also anyone use Michelin Pilot before? How is it? Wat is the price now??

 

2) Steel braided brake hose. Actually most commonly seen is HEL or Goodridge. Which is more prefered??

 

3) Front and rear signal light. Goin to change to those sleek carbon fibre look type. Where to get it. And how is it goin to mount onto my CBR954?? For the rear..I see other bike got those bracket to hold their little tiny signal light. Where to get this bracket??

 

4) Front head light. Is Philip one the best?? Any other good recommendation??

JuZ mY 2 Cents WorTH

 

1) Juz changed to sportec M1,real gd with the grip dry/wet weather...Can corner with confident..Read recent review its No.1 for street use next to racetec k2

 

2)Im using Hel so far ok but wet weather got funny sound & jerks on the front braking but after changed to EBC sintered problem solved.U can wait for braking coming to LAB review not bad price too!

 

3)U can get @ LAB + installation price not sure ask Darren..The Bracket might be PUIG got mine done oso now NO. plate more slanted & sporty!

 

4)Tinking of changing head light too..White light is bright but not far unless u use Philips Diamond Vision or Install HID (Super Costly $100+)

 

Hope I helped Cheers! :cheeky:
